Emblemaria pandionis is a charming blenny species prized for its distinctive appearance and peaceful nature, making it a suitable addition to many marine aquariums. This species is available in various sizes, allowing hobbyists to select the best fit for their tank setup.
Care Level: Moderate. Emblemaria pandionis requires stable water parameters and a well-established aquarium.
Temperament: Generally peaceful and shy, this blenny coexists well with other non-aggressive tank mates.
Diet: Carnivorous. Feed a varied diet including finely chopped meaty foods such as mysis shrimp, brine shrimp, and specialised prepared marine fish foods to ensure optimal health.
Tank Requirements: A minimum tank size of 30 litres (approximately 8 gallons) is recommended to provide adequate space and hiding places. The aquarium should include live rock or similar structures to offer shelter and territories.
Reef Compatibility: Yes, this species is reef safe and will not harm corals or invertebrates.
Lighting and Water Flow: Standard marine aquarium lighting and moderate water flow are suitable for Emblemaria pandionis.
Origin: Not Provided.
Maximum Size: Approximately 5 cm (2 inches).
